Find two equivalent ratios for 3:4 using multiplication

A. 6:8
B.9:12
C. 6:12

Answer:

A and B

Step-by-step explanation:

3:4 multiplied by 2 is 6:8

3x2=6 4x2=8

3:4 multiplied by 3 is 9:12

3x3=9 4x3=12
